Illahee State Park Fishing Pier
This 360 ft long treasure is located inside the Illahee State Park in Bremerton in the state of Washington. The term “Illahee” refers to the earth or country in the native words of Chinook Wawa. Situated near the Puget Sound, this pier is known for its shallow waters which are a perfect breeding ground for large and healthy fishes. The pier has ample fishing spots, providing even the most amateur angler enough room to cast and catch fishes.
